Register
Login
Add A Venue
Add Supplier
Menu
England
Scotland
Wales
N Ireland
International
R.O Ireland
Australia
New Zealand
Suppliers
Product Launch Venues In Christchurch
Tait Technology Centre
Christchurch, Harewood
Conveniently located 2km from Christchurch Airport, Tait Technology Centre offers a purpose-built confere...